Number System | Rational Numbers |
---|---|
Powers | |
Squares, Square roots, Cubes, Cube roots | |
Playing with numbers | |
Algebra | Algebraic Expressions |
Geometry | Understanding shapes |
Representing 3-D in 2-D | |
Construction | |
Mensuration | |
Data handling | |
Introduction to graphs |

Q1. How many chapters are included in NCERT Class 8 Mathematics?
Ans. There are a total of 16 chapters included in NCERT Class 8 Mathematics for students.
